According to Gianluca Di Marzio, the agent of Napoli goalkeeper Pepe Reina is heading to Italy in order to hold talks about the Spaniard’s future with the club.

Reina, 34, first joined Napoli on loan in 2013, and after one season with Bayern Munich, he headed back to Naples in 2015 on a permanent basis.

The former Liverpool hero has made nearly 100 appearances in his second spell at the Stadio San Paolo, but recent speculation has suggested that a move away could be on the cards.

Not only did The Sun claim that Napoli are open to selling Reina this summer, but The Northern Echo also reported earlier this week that Newcastle want to sign Reina in a £4million deal.

Magpies boss Rafael Benitez doesn’t seem entirely convinced by Rob Elliot, Karl Darlow or Matz Sels, and a move for Reina makes perfect sense given that he signed him for both Liverpool and Napoli.

Now, in a story that may well interest Newcastle, Sky Italia Gianluca Di Marzio reports that Reina’s agent Manuel Garcia Quilon is heading to Italy in order to hold talks with Napoli about Reina’s future with the club.

Reina’s contract with Napoli ends in 2018, meaning that Quilon wants to find out whether Napoli intend to extend his contract – and if they don’t, Reina could pursue other options this summer.

With Newcastle seemingly the logical landing spot for Reina, Il Mattino reported earlier this week that Napoli are keen on Arsenal’s Wojciech Szczesny, which could free Reina up for a move to St. James’ Park.
